The Golda Meier library is a very valuable resource, open to any Wisconsin resident. If you want to check anything out, you have to get a very reasonably priced "friends of the library" card, but anyone can wander in and consult the databases and work in the stacks.

If you are considering UWM read the following from my perspective - The University of Wisconsin-Milwaukee is undergoing huge transformations that will continue throughout the next decade. Top research facilities, new buildings, professors, and increased investment brought Milwaukee to the top of my list. I am studying architecture at the wonderful School of Architecture and Urban Planning where open studio spaces, big windows, and modern design inspire my everyday work. I am staying in Cambridge Commons which is a res-hall in between the wonderful downtown Milwaukee area and the main campus. Milwaukee (and more specifically Cambridge Commons) by far has the best dorm rooms. They are apartment style with A/C, four people that share two bedrooms, one main/general area, one full-size fridge, and a large bathroom. The campus features competitive D1 varsity sports along with growing popularity in intramural competition. The main campus is situated in one of the wealthy suburbs of Milwaukee so crime has never been a concern of mine and is 3 minutes away from Bradford Beach (a popular summer location for beach volleyball and hanging out with the locals) and the expansive lake park. Overall, UWM was a great choice for me and am proud that I chose to be a Panther!

The University of Wisconsin - Milwaukee is a hidden gem. Some people from the Madison area don't have the best perception of Milwaukee as a city, but the truth is Milwaukee is very nice. The campus is situated on Milwaukees North East side just a few blocks south of Shorewood and a few blocks west of beautiful lake drive. As long as you stay east of the river you are in a fantastic area.
Especially compared to Marquette, UW - Milwaukee has little issues in terms of safety. I feel safe around campus and it is patrolled regularly.
The campus has both older style brick buildings as well as newer modern buildings. The freshman dorms are nicer than most colleges and they are all suite style so you only share a bathroom with other suite mates.
The sports teams are D1 and are very competitive in the Horizon League conference. Just last year, they beat the Badgers basketball team at Madison. This year they were just shy of winning the conference championship with a chance to go to the NCAA tournament. Overall I have enjoyed my experience so far and highly recommend.
